AS1FD-M3/I Equivalent & Substitute Parts Reference

Part Overview

The Vishay AS1FD-M3/I is an active automotive-grade avalanche diode rectifier. It features a 200 V maximum DC reverse voltage and 1.5 A average rectified current in a DO-219AB (SMF) surface-mount package. This device is RoHS3 compliant and REACH unaffected. Key Parameters

Parameter AS1FD-M3/I Value
Category Diodes, Rectifiers
Manufacturer Vishay General Semiconductor - Diodes Division
Technology Avalanche
Voltage - DC Reverse (Vr) (Max) 200 V
Current - Average Rectified (Io) 1.5 A
Voltage - Forward (Vf) (Max) @ If 1.15 V @ 1.5 A
Speed Standard Recovery >500ns, >200mA (Io)
Reverse Recovery Time (trr) 1.3 µs
Current - Reverse Leakage @ Vr 5 µA @ 200 V
Capacitance @ Vr, F 8.8 pF @ 4V, 1 MHz
Grade Automotive
Qualification AEC-Q101
Mounting Type Surface Mount
Package / Case DO-219AB
Supplier Device Package DO-219AB (SMF)
Operating Temperature - Junction -55°C ~ 175°C
RoHS Status ROHS3 Compliant
REACH Status REACH Unaffected
ECCN EAR99
HTSUS 8541.10.0080
Product Status Active

Frequently Asked Questions (FAQ)

Q1: What are the primary criteria for substituting AS1FD-M3/I in rectifier designs?
A1: Primary criteria include identical values for DC reverse voltage, average rectified current, forward voltage drop, reverse recovery time, reverse leakage current, capacitance, package type (DO-219AB), temperature rating, automotive qualification (AEC-Q101), and compliance certifications (RoHS3, REACH).

Q2: Are AS1FD-M3/I, AS1FD-M3/H, and AS1FDHM3/H mutually interchangeable?
A2: Yes, based on the listed parameters, these parts are mutually interchangeable with respect to electrical performance, mechanical fit, and regulatory status.

Q3: Does packaging type affect substitution?
A3: Electrical and mechanical characteristics are unaffected by packaging (Tape & Reel vs. Cut Tape), but packaging impacts feeding methods in automated assembly processes.
